The chess endgame with a king and a pawn versus a king is one of the most important and fundamental endgames other than the basic checkmates. The fifty-move rule in chess states that a player can claim a draw if no capture has been made and no pawn has been moved in the last fifty moves for this purpose a move consists of a player completing their turn followed by the opponent completing their turn.
